【高并發系列】21、JDK并發容器 - 高效讀取 CopyOnWriteArrayList

對于CopyOnWriteArrayList來說,讀取之間不加鎖,而且寫入也不阻塞讀取操作,隻有寫入和寫入之間需要同步等待;

讀取:

/** The array, accessed only via getArray/setArray. */
private transient volatile Object[] array;
public E get(int index) {
    return get(getArray(), index);
}
/**
 * Gets the array.  Non-private so as to also be accessible
 * from CopyOnWriteArraySet class.
 */
final Object[] getArray() {
    return array;
}
@SuppressWarnings("unchecked")
private E get(Object[] a, int index) {
    return (E) a[index];
}
           

内部數組array不會發生修改,隻會被另一個array替換,是以在讀取代碼中沒有同步控制和鎖操作也可以保證資料的安全;

寫操作:

/**
 * Appends the specified element to the end of this list.
 *
 * @param e element to be appended to this list
 * @return {@code true} (as specified by {@link Collection#add})
 */
public boolean add(E e) {
    final ReentrantLock lock = this.lock;
    lock.lock();
    try {
        Object[] elements = getArray();
        int len = elements.length;
        Object[] newElements = Arrays.copyOf(elements, len + 1);
        newElements[len] = e;
        setArray(newElements);
        return true;
    } finally {
        lock.unlock();
    }
}
           

對于寫-寫操作加鎖,使用Arrays.copyOf()對數組複制,并加入新增元素,并使用setArray()替換老的數組array,并且因為array變量是volatile類型的,是以可以被讀取線程所見;
